Azerbaijan advances eight positions in Travel and Tourism Development Index

Azerbaijan ranked 63rd among 117 countries in the World Economic Forum Travel and Tourism Development Index 2021, Report informs, citing the World Economic Forum.
According to the information, this means an advance of 8 positions compared to the 2019 index.
Among the region's countries, Georgia ranked 44th, Turkiye was 45th, and Kazakhstan was 66th.
According to the statement, sanctions imposed against Russia due to the war with Ukraine and travel restrictions have created pressure on the tourism sector, increased travel time and costs. However, Russian citizens are the main visitors to various destinations such as Azerbaijan, Georgia, Turkiye, Israel, the United Arab Emirates, and Thailand.
